Re: My non EFI Car
yeah this year the weather has bee so un-predictable its not funny.
the up side is we had a near perfect day today weather wise, unfortunately some of the cars wern't so good.
v6bucket broke his slave cylinder bracket in the first run so that was the end of his day, my brothers nitrous VN V6 only got one run due to a corrupted tune and us chasing our tails for half the day till we realised it was the tune.
Thankfully due to v6bucket being out but having qualified my brother was able to slot into his spot and got one run in the eliminators. we had no idea of what the car would run and had to pick a dial in, so we said 8.0 and it probably would have done it, the brother was flustered from getting the nod to run about 2 seconds after getting it back off the trailer and then having to roll straight into the staging lanes. Anyways he had to chase down a 10.2 i think dial in, he ran a 8.9 with a botched start and only just got beaten!!! I was hoping he'd win it so then he'd get a second eliminator run!!!
the gemini had no issues and ran consistant 8.3 and 8.4's and got pipped in the second eliminator before we ran out of time and had to get off the air field!
was a great day and well run all things considered (weather etc) i totally enjoyed myself but feel really bad i didn't pickup on the tune issue earlier so the brothers 4 hour tow and entry fees wern't so wasted but we'll try and get down to WSID before too long and get him some track time!

Re: My non EFI Car
As has already been stated, it did rain on Saturday, but we were able to kick back in the arvo, have a few drinks & do some bench racing.
It was good catch up with Holden202, helped with some questions that I have with this computer tuning stuff.
Yes I did break the clutch slave cylinder bracket. On closer inspection I found the real reason why the bracket was in 4 pieces. These pressure plate drive straps belong here. Also bent another set. The rivet that attaches the straps to the plate has sheared when I let the clutch out at 6000rpm. Now to find the $1000 for a different type clutch & a steel flywheel. On the positive side the blue Smurf went well, but I'll discuss that elsewhere.
